Key Responsibilities:

  • Treat bone muscle and joint disorders affecting the feet.

  • Treat conditions such as corns calluses ingrown nails tumors shortened tendons bunions cysts and abscesses by surgical methods.

  • Treat conditions such as osteomyelitis necrotizing fasciitis or chronic infected wounds through surgical intervention.

  • Educate patients about the benefits of foot care.

  • Advise patients about treatments and foot care techniques necessary for prevention of future problems.

  • Manage diabetic foot conditions.

  • Correct deformities by means of custom orthoses plaster casts and/or strapping in conjunction with an orthotist.

  • Diagnose diseases and deformities of the foot using medical histories physical examinations x-rays and laboratory test results.
